Spain’s ENCE sets roadshow for €250 million seven-year notes

By Paul A. Harris

Portland, Ore., Oct. 20 – Madrid-based ENCE Energia y Celulosa, SA plans to start a roadshow on Wednesday for a €250 million offering of seven-year senior notes (Ba3/BB-), according to a market source.

The roadshow wraps up Friday, and the Rule 144A and Regulation S deal is set to price thereafter.

Global coordinator JPMorgan will bill and deliver.

BBVA, CaixaBank and Santander are active bookrunners.

Bankia, Citigroup, Sabadell and Bankinter are bookrunners.

The notes come with three years of call protection.

The pulp producer plans to use the proceeds to redeem all of its 7¼% senior notes due 2020.
